This internet librarian is on a mission to archive the world-wide-web prior to it is deleted
Mark Graham fears that worthwhile components of human history are getting wiped out before our eyes.
As the director of the Wayback Machine, a website that information how particular person webpages have changed around time, he is acutely conscious of how crucial it is to keep a document of what is remaining posted – and the place.
He has observed adjustments ranging from a benign spelling correction, to edits in government sites, to the dismantling of media retailers by dictators.
“If we want long term generations to have the possibility to understand from history then it is essential that record be available to them,” Graham states. “Over the past couple a long time, pretty much all of human knowledge communication has been digital and whilst that has afforded a remarkable improve in the quantity and the frequency, it has also introduced with it a fragility.”
The Wayback Device, which shops 525bn webpages, does particularly what its name implies. It is a time equipment for the web. It is aim is to protect beneficial components our of collective record that have been recorded on the web. Without the need of it, whole world wide web web pages documenting our collective background can be wiped out with a single simply click.
“Most societies spot importance on preserving artefacts of their tradition and heritage,” the enterprise writes on its web page. “Devoid of this sort of artefacts , civilisation has no memory and no system to discover from its successes and failures. Our tradition now provides a lot more and far more artifacts in digital variety.” The Wayback equipment aims to protect individuals artefacts and generate an world-wide-web library for researchers, historians and students.
A lot more not too long ago, its father or mother company the Online Archive has been thrust into the spotlight for archiving Parler, a social community that has been introduced offline and has been accused of internet hosting posts made use of to system the riot in Washington DC on January 6.
Amazon Website Companies terminated Parler’s world-wide-web hosting contract for failing to sufficiently average violent information. Its record on the Internet Archive aided electronic sleuths keep track of down end users who experienced shared images of the riots.
But whilst the electronic path from the riots has unquestionably been vital for investigators searching for one-way links to American white supremacists, Graham argues that it is significant to archive as much of the world wide web as achievable.
Corporations and folks have grow to be less worried with internet hosting their possess services and are rather making use of third functions this kind of as Microsoft, Amazon, Google or IBM. Area registrations are also presented by personal companies like GoDaddy and BlueHost. If they terminate contracts with their clients – whether or not willingly or not – people websites could simply vanish.
